Time lapse North Pacific Starfish.
In certain areas (and every now and then) of PortPhillip Bay Melbourne there is an invasion of North Pacific Starfish. These Starfish move through practically devouring everything that cannot move out of the way. U/W footage copyright Pang Quong contact [email protected]

How Do Starfish See?
Do starfish have eyes? How do starfish see? In this video we answer the question. Starfish do, in fact have eyes. They have a single eye at the end of each arm. The use those eyes to look around the ocean floor.

Peter Watts: Conscious Ants and Human Hives
The talk is part of the Popular Science Forum Ratio 2017 (http://ratio.bg/)
Watts’ talk will go over some of the insanely counterintuitive findings about the nature of consciousness, ranging from insects who seem able to recognize themselves in mirrors to Humans who drive across town, commit murder, clean up the mess and drive back home again, unconscious the whole time. Also the risks we face as we start playing around with brain-to-brain interfaces and Liu et al’s “neural lace” (widely recognised after Elon Musk’s Neuralink venture was announced).

Peter Watts' interview for the Blindsight Project website
Watch the short and read the story behind it at https://blindsight.space/
Blindsight is a short film created by Danil Krivoruchko in collaboration with artists from around the globe between 2016 and 2020. The film is based on the eponymous sci-fi novel by Peter Watts. This is a non-commercial self-funded project.
